Smoking emitting from device

In the case of smoke emitting from the product, be

sure to turn off the power switch and remove the

power plug immediately. Using the product while it is

smoking may cause

a fire or electric

shock. Contact the

dealer immediately.

No image or sound

In this case, be sure to turn off the power switch

and remove the

power plug. In

case of sudden

loss of image or

sound, stop using

the device and

contact the dealer

immediately.

Dropped or broken case

In this case, be

sure to turn off

the power switch

and remove the

power plug. Please

contact the dealer

for service. Do not

use the device as

it may cause fire or

electric shock.

Use only 110V or 220V AC outlets

Use only 110V or 220V AC power outlets, otherwise

fire or electric shock

may result.

Keep power plug dust free

Keep dust free of

the power cord.

Dust can cause

the insulation to

be damaged and

cause a fire.

Do not service, modify or disassemble this

device

This device contains

high voltage and

fragile objects inside

that may cause electric

shock, fire or damage

of the parts. Read the

warranty booklet and

contact the dealer for

more information.

Keep foreign objects off the device

Objects on the device can cause fire or electric shock

When there is foreign object inside the device, turn off

the power supply and remove the power plug before

contacting the dealer. Be sure not to allow children

insert foreign objects

inside the device.
